Output 3e7787df6252db95372a291fc7be64bcf9c5bd484bb9f3548a3117492e0851c2:31

value
2360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af6b3b099edc852a847fa271c179a8ae3bb4310 OP_EQUAL
address
3EMniAa24UbjNiLnW83oMdXN5iZHZLhArq
transaction
3e7787df6252db95372a291fc7be64bcf9c5bd484bb9f3548a3117492e0851c2
spent
true